MCS-51单片机模拟考试试题与解答

版权申诉
0 下载量 72 浏览量 更新于2024-07-15 收藏 299KB DOC 举报
"mcs51单片机期末考试题.doc" 这份文档是关于MCS-51系列单片机的一份模拟考试题,涵盖了选择题、填空题、判断题、简答题、作图题和设计题等多种题型,主要测试考生对于MCS-51单片机的基础知识和应用能力。MCS-51是一种广泛应用的8位单片机,由美国Intel公司开发,广泛应用于各种嵌入式系统中。 一、选择题部分涉及到的知识点: 1. MCS-51单片机的指令系统:例如题目中提到的从程序存储器取数据的指令,正确答案是采用“MOV A, @DPTR”指令。 2. 寻址方式:题目中提到的位寻址和字节寻址,如20H、30H、00H和70H这些地址,其中20H和30H是可字节寻址的,00H是内部RAM的直接寻址区,70H是可位寻址的。 3. 指令语法:如PUSH、ADD、MOVX和MOV等指令的正确用法。 二、填空题部分涉及的知识点: 1. 微机系统的基本组成:硬件和软件。 2. 8051单片机的复位引脚RST的工作原理,以及复位状态的确定。 3. 存储器类型:RAM(随机存取存储器)和ROM(只读存储器),RAM的特点是易失性。 4. 补码运算:负数的补码表示方法,如-102的补码表示。 5. PC(程序计数器)的作用和特性,它是决定程序执行顺序的关键,并且在8051中是16位的。 三、判断题和简答题部分可能涵盖单片机的进制转换、数据类型处理、I/O接口操作、中断系统、定时器/计数器的应用等内容。 四、作图题和设计题则需要考生实际设计电路图,并编写控制程序,涉及的知识点包括: 1. 如何利用扩展存储器(如6264)来扩展单片机的数据存储空间,以及线选法产生片选信号的原理。 2. 控制LED灯的编程设计,这通常涉及IO口的配置和循环控制。 3. 数码管显示的控制,可能涉及动态扫描或静态显示的实现,以及按键输入的处理。 4. 通过编程实现计数功能,如题目中的加1和减1操作,这涉及到变量的更新和条件判断。 这些问题全面地考察了考生对于MCS-51单片机的硬件结构、指令系统、存储器管理、I/O操作、程序设计等多个方面的理解和应用能力。通过解答这些题目,考生可以巩固和提升在MCS-51单片机领域的专业技能。
2024-12-04 上传